Nasturtium Black Velvet

A unique colour in Nasturtiums! Deepest velvety, red-black blooms in abundance above fresh green foliage on neat, dwarf plants. Sure to create an eyecatching display in borders or containers when accompanied by Milkmaid. Will grow in any well-drained soil in full sun.

Culinary note: The peppery flavour of the leaves and colourful flowers will enrich salads and the unripened seeds can used like capers – delicious combined with cream cheese or butter in canapés.

Height Up To 23cm (9.1in)

Spread Up To 30cm (11.8in)

Hardiness & Longevity: Half-Hardy Annual

Ideal For: Patio, Kitchen Garden, Cottage Gardens, Exotic Garden

Position In: Full Sun

Sowing Months: March to May

Flowering Months: June to September
